Lady Charmain HN1948, Royal Doulton Figurine Jester where at sixteen he becameLady Charmian (HN1948) was designed by Leslie Harradine and issued by Royal Doulton from 1940 to 1973, standing 8 inches tall as part of the Harradine Classics range. She is presented in a flowing turquoise gown swept gracefully around her figure, a rich red shawl draped across her shoulders a colourway that gives the piece a vivid, warm contrast characteristic of Harradine's most accomplished lady studies.
